I'm used to Teva's more serious hiking sandals, which I love, but I wanted a pair that looked slightly more cosmopolitan, and less like I just stepped off the trail. These leather original universals do the trick. Although I wouldn't say any Teva sandal is exactly the pinnacle of fashion, I think these guys look really good and have more of a Birkenstock than a Chaco aesthetic. I was worried that having a less substantial sole would be disappointing coming from Teva's hiking-oriented lines, but I've actually found them to be just fine for even middle distances (like 5 or 6 miles) as long as I don't have a heavy bag. I think I even prefer them to my chunkier sandals for just wearing around the house or in the neighborhood because they are lighter and cooler. I was also worried that coming from nylon and neoprene lined uppers in my other Tevas to all leather could be a rough transition, but I have found the leather to be comfortable with no break-in period. Overall, I would definitely recommend if you're looking for a sandal that looks smart and understated and you're not trying to cover big milage or carry a big bag. If you're between sizes, order a half size down.
